How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Green Ridge?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Green Ridge Studio Apartments | $1,253 | $1,138 | $1,388 |
| Green Ridge 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,411 | $675 | $3,993 |
| Green Ridge 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,883 | $710 | $3,471 |
| Green Ridge 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,135 | $1,200 | $3,863 |
| Green Ridge 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,956 | $400 | $3,062 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Green Ridge
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Green Ridge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Green Ridge ranges from $675 to $3,993 with an average monthly rent of $1,411.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Green Ridge c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Green Ridge range from $710 to $3,471.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,883.
How expensive are Green Ridge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 23 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Green Ridge on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,200 to $3,863 - averaging $2,135 for the location.
